Just Nature’s Soul to Experience (Jasper National Park) by Mark Stevens Via Flickr: A setting looking to the northwest while taking in views of the Maligne River flowing by a nearby forest. This is in Jasper National Park at a roadside parking area along the Maligne Lake Road. What I loved about this setting was the backdrop of the Medicine Lake Slabs off in the distance with this river and forest setting. In composing this image, I zoomed in a little with the focal length and then aligned myself such that the river, as a leading line, would be more or less centered in the image. I had to watch the metering, as there were definitely highlights that could be blown from the mid-afternoon sunshine present. But I also wanted to be able to bring out the more shadowed areas in the nearby forest later on in post production. I later worked with control points in DxO PhotoLab 6 and then made some adjustments to bring out the contrast, saturation and brightness I wanted for the final image.
